Royal Court: Custodian of the Two Holy Mosques Calls for Performing Rain Prayers on Thursday

Riyadh– The Custodian of the Two Holy Mosques King Salman bin Abdulaziz Al Saud called for the performance of Istisqa (rain-seeking) prayers all over the Kingdom next Thursday, the Royal Court said in a statement issued today.

The statement recalled that the performance of Istisqa prayers is a good imitation following the deeds of Prophet Mohammad (peace be upon him).

The Custodian of the Two Holy Mosques called on everybody to pray to Allah Almighty for repentance, forgiveness, and mercy.

Saudi Taekwondo Team to Participates in World Taekwondo Championships in Mexico

Guadalajara-- The Saudi Taekwondo team will participate today in the World Taekwondo Championship, which will continue until November 20 in the Mexican city of Guadalajara, with the participation of 122 countries.

The Saudi team will participate with four players; Fahd Al-Samih 54 kg, Riyad Al-Dhafri 58 kg, Ali Al-Mabrouk 80 kg, Donia Abu Taleb 49 kg, and a technical and administrative staff.

Saudi Women Volleyball Team Leaves for Jordan to Participate in West Asia Championship

Riyadh– The Saudi women volleyball team mission yesterday left for Amman to participate in the first West Asia Championship that is scheduled to be held between November 15 and 24.

The Saudi team will play its first matches tomorrow against Iraq at 12 noon.

The Saudi team plays in the first group along with Palestine, Iraq, Lebanon and Syria, where the second group comprises Jordan, Kuwait, Oman, Qatar and the UAE.
